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roof and installing a new roofing system to ensure durability and protection for a property. The process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or worn materials, and applying new roofing layers suited to the property's needs. Contractors may use various materials such as built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, or modified bitumen, depending on the specific requirements and preferences of the property owner. The goal is to create a weather-tight, long-lasting surface that can withstand local climate conditions and provide reliable coverage.

This service addresses common problems associated with aging or damaged flat roofs, including leaks, ponding water, blistering, or cracking. Over time, flat roofs can develop issues that compromise their ability to protect the structure beneath, leading to water infiltration, mold growth, or structural deterioration. Replacing a flat roof helps eliminate these issues by installing a new, more resilient surface that reduces the risk of leaks and water damage, ultimately extending the lifespan of the roof and maintaining the integrity of the building.

Flat roof replacement services are often utilized by commercial properties, such as warehouses, retail stores, and office buildings, which frequently feature flat roofing systems due to their practicality and cost-effectiveness. However, resid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s, such as apartment complexes, condominiums, or certain modern-style homes, also benefit from these services. The choice of replacement roofing depends on the property's design, usage, and the specific challenges posed by the local environment, making professional assessment and installation essential.

The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Belton,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Size Factors - The cost of flat roof repl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. Smaller roofs may be closer to the lower end, while larger or more complex projects can approach the higher estimates.

Material Types - Different roofing materials influence the overall cost, with options like EPDM rubber costing around $4 to $8 per square foot, and TPO or PVC membranes generally falling between $5 and $10 per square foot.

Labor and Accessibility - Labor costs for flat roof replacement can vary based on accessibility and roof complexity, often adding $1,000 to $3,000 to the total project. Easy-to-access roofs tend to reduce labor expenses compared to those requiring special equipment.

Additional Expenses - Expenses such as tear-off, disposal, and permits can increase the overall cost by $1,000 to $4,000, depending on local regulations and the condition of the existing roof. These factors should be considered when budgeting for the project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ration of a flat roof replacement can vary depending on the size and complexity of the project, but local contractors usually provide an estimated timeline during the consultation.

What materials are commonly used for flat roof replacements? Common materials include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es such as TPO or PVC, selected based on durability and suitability for the building.

Are there any signs that indicate a flat roof needs to be replaced? Signs include persistent leaks, ponding water, extensive membrane damage, or frequent repairs, which may suggest a replacement is necessary.

Can flat roof replacement be done during any season? Many contractors recommend scheduling during milder weather conditions, but availability may vary based on local climate and contractor schedules.
